Summary:
- This article discusses upcoming educational contacts between the International Space Station (ISS) and schools or educational organizations around the world.
- The ISS crew members, who are astronauts from various space agencies, will engage in live video calls with students to answer their questions and share their experiences of living and working in space.
- These educational contacts are part of the Amateur Radio on the International Space Station (ARISS) program, which aims to inspire students to pursue careers in science, technology, engineering, and mathematics (STEM) fields.
